Why are Indians interested in investing in Berkshire Hathaway (class A) Stock (BRK.A) from India?

Warren Buffett, widely regarded as the greatest investor of all time, has transformed Berkshire Hathaway into one of the world’s most successful conglomerates, becoming the first non-tech U.S. firm to reach a $1 trillion market value. This milestone not only showcased the company’s strength but also solidified Buffett’s position as one of the wealthiest individuals globally, with a net worth surpassing $100 billion.

Berkshire’s $297 billion portfolio includes 44 stocks, featuring giants like Apple, Coca-Cola, American Express, and Amazon, generating around $5 billion annually in dividends. The company also dominates the U.S. insurance market with businesses like GEICO and Berkshire Hathaway Reinsurance Group, holding $811 billion in assets and ranking as the largest insurer in 2024.

In Q3, Berkshire reported earnings of $26.3 billion, with insurance driving 30% of profits, followed by manufacturing, services, and retail at 29%. It also owns Burlington Northern Santa Fe (BNSF), one of North America’s largest railroads.

Berkshire’s ventures in India, including Berkshire Hathaway HomeServices Orenda India and BerkshireInsurance.com, highlight Buffett’s interest in the market's potential. About Berkshire Hathaway (class A)

What is Berkshire Hathaway?

Berkshire Hathaway is a prominent American multinational conglomerate founded in 1839 and transformed by ace investor Warren Buffett in 1965. It is best known for its diversified portfolio of subsidiaries and substantial investments in publicly traded companies. Berkshire Hathaway is headquartered in Omaha, Nebraska, and ranks among the world’s largest and most influential companies.

 

What does Berkshire Hathaway do?

Berkshire Hathaway owns and manages a wide range of businesses across sectors including insurance, railroads, energy, manufacturing, retail, and consumer products. It also makes strategic investments in well-known public companies. Through its subsidiaries and investments, Berkshire Hathaway aims to build long-term value by acquiring strong companies with reliable earnings and robust competitive advantages.

 

Berkshire Hathaway Products & Services

Product/ServiceWhat It Does
GEICOAuto insurance provider offering affordable policies
BNSF RailwayOperates one of North America’s largest freight railroad networks
Berkshire Hathaway EnergySupplies electricity, natural gas, and renewable energy solutions
Dairy QueenGlobal fast-food chain known for ice cream and quick-service meals
Fruit of the LoomManufacturer of casual apparel and underwear
Clayton HomesManufacturer and seller of modular and manufactured homes
Berkshire Hathaway HomeServicesResidential real estate brokerage services

What are the returns that Berkshire Hathaway (BRK.A) has given in Indian Rupees in the last 5 years?

An investor investing in US stocks from India not only benefits from stock or capital returns but also gets the benefit of dollar appreciation versus rupees.

If an Indian resident would have invested in Berkshire Hathaway from India, 5 years ago then the total returns (including dollar appreciation) from Berkshire Hathaway stock would be 138%. The annualised return would be 19%.

To understand this in simple terms, capital appreciation in the last 5 years from Berkshire Hathaway stocks would be 98.88%.
On top of this, the investors will enjoy the gains from appreciation in dollar value versus rupees which would be 19.44%. The calculation is for the last 5 years.

Hence, investing in US stocks from the US will only give an investor capital gains, but an Indian investor will enjoy additional gains from dollar appreciation.
